Specifications
- Brand: Intel
- Model: SSD DC S4500 Series
- Part Number (MPN): SSDSC2KB960G7
- Capacity: 960 GB
- Form Factor: 2.5-inch, 7 mm
- Interface: SATA III, 6 Gb/s
- NAND: Intel 3D NAND TLC
- Life remaining: 99–100% verified
- Sequential Read: Up to 500 MB/s
- Sequential Write: Up to 480 MB/s
- Random Read (4K, QD32): Up to 72,000 IOPS
- Random Write (4K, QD32): Up to 31,000 IOPS
- Endurance: ~990 TBW (≈0.66 DWPD over 5 years)
- MTBF: 2,000,000 hours
- Workload Profile: Read Intensive (data center / server)
- Firmware: SCV10142
Enterprise features
- End-to-End Data Path Protection
- Enhanced Power Loss Data Protection (PLI capacitor array)
- AES 256-bit hardware encryption
- Hot-plug SATA, DevSleep low-power state
- Optimized for read-intensive server and storage workloads
